> > > On Fri, Apr 11, 2008 at 11:16:13AM -0400, Tao Yu wrote:
> > > > A quick question, what are those files in this directory used for?
> > >
> > > They are not used for anything, but they are important part of
> > > the history (more than the logs) of the cluster. You can remove
> > > old if you don't need them and you can also limit the number of
> > > kept files with the crm_config options pe-input-series-max,
> > > pe-warn-series-max, and pe-error-series-max. The -1 value means
> > > unlimited.
